Ivanovich Vargas
Director, Office of Diversity and Inclusion
Rehn Hall, 129A
Ivan Vargas serves as the Director of Diversity and Inclusion for the College of Business and Analytics, where he leads initiatives focused on student success, retention, and expanding pathways into business education. Since joining SIU in 2019, he has supported students through roles in advising, admissions, and student life, and now directs the Saluki Opportunities Awareness Residency (SOAR) while assisting the Dean’s Student Advisory Board in executing impactful student-driven programming. Ivan holds bachelor’s degrees in finance, accounting, and criminology and criminal justice, and is currently pursuing a Master of Accountancy with plans to become a CPA. He is passionate about building a community where every student feels supported, empowered, and confident in their future.

Jasmine Winters
Chief Academic Advisor
Rehn Hall, 125A
Jasmine Winters joined the College of Business and Analytics as the Chief Academic Advisor in 2019. She graduated from the College of Business in 2005 with her degree in marketing followed by her MBA in 2008. She has been with the SIU for over 18 years serving as an academic advisor. Before coming to the CoBA she worked with the School of Architecture. In addition to the positions that she has held on campus, Winters has also served on a number of university committees.

Leslee Hammers
Online Undergraduate Program Coordinator
Rehn Hall, 314A
Leslee Hammers began working in the Online Undergraduate Program in Spring 2017. She has a bachelor’s degree in Information Systems Technologies and a master’s degree in Curriculum and Instruction, with an emphasis in Instructional Technology. Leslee was a non-traditional student for both of these degrees, working and attending school part-time. She had one daughter before she started working on her bachelor’s degree and another daughter before she finished. Leslee felt like she needed to obtain an education to be better able to stress the importance of a college education to her daughters.
Leslee has been interested in adult education, especially online education, since she began working on her bachelor’s degree. Having worked in different roles in the College of Business and Analytics since 2004, she is excited for the opportunity to utilize her education and years of institutional knowledge to assist students and faculty with online education.

Michelle Johanson
Online Undergraduate Program Director
Rehn Hall, 312A
Michelle Johanson joined the College of Business and Analytics as an accountant in the Dean’s Office in 2015. She was promoted to business manager and is currently the online undergraduate program manager. Managing the online program is a perfect fit for Johanson. She has experience working with online programs in the College of Business and Analytics and in the Workforce Education and Development Off Campus Degree Program as a teaching assistant and a research assistant.
Johanson is a three degree Saluki. She earned her bachelor’s degree in finance, master’s degree with a major in workforce education and development focusing on instructional design and E-learning and a Master of Accountancy, all from SIU Carbondale.
